I am trying to write a contract report and I have a statement << Rest of Page Intentionally Left Blank >> that needs to appear if signatures are moved to a page all alone but be suppressed if the signatures fit on a page following the scope.

Does anyone know a way to make this work? The signatures are in the middle of an 80+ page document so they do not appear on a final page.

I don't know of a way.

Crystal is not very 'knowledgeable' of where an item is being displayed on the page. Meaning that it doesn't know if the signatures are on the same page or not, until it is too late.

I wish I had better insight. I have tried counting lines or characters, and again, Crystal doesn't 'know' where the cursor is, especially with proportional fonts and sizes, and I would not say that I have had much luck.
